My Son is was making a map and he did something that when he saved the map he ending up with what he called a Fatal Error.  Now his map will not open and he thinks he has lost everything.

Has he lost everthing or is there a way to recover his map?

When opening the map the message says
"ParseEntity:{not found
GetLastError() = 0
An unrecoverable error has occured. Would you like to edit Preferences before exiting Q3Radiant?"

It's been a long for me as well...
Hope you can solve it, and for future mapping: I always save my maps with increasing numbers: mapname_0001, mapname_0002, this way I can always get the last working map if something goes wrong (be warned, numbers will rise very fast, especially if you're as cautious as I was, I ended up with over 200 mapsaves).
